The decision to approve or deny the application will be based on compliance with the following ordinance criteria:
Rivergrove Land Development Ordinance (RLDO) Article 4 Sec. 4.010-4.110 Type IV Procedures; Article 5 Sec. 5.010-5.100 Residential Zone; Article 6 Section 6.235 – 6.236 Annexations; Article 8 Public Hearing, Notice and Deliberations; ORS 222.111; City/County Urban Growth Management Area Agreement; Rivergrove Comprehensive Plan

Issues regarding compliance with pertinent code standards may provide the basis for an appeal to the City Council and shall be raised and submitted before the record is closed. Issues must be raised with sufficient specificity to enable the Planning Commission to respond to the issue. Failure to raise an issue in person or by letter, or failure to provide sufficient specificity to afford the decision-maker an opportunity to respond to the issue precludes appeal to the State Land Use Board of Appeals on that issue. In addition, failure to raise constitutional or other issues relating to proposed conditions of approval, with sufficient specificity to allow the Planning Commission to respond to the issue, precludes an action for damages in circuit court.

The Planning Commission shall review the application under a Type IV procedure and make a recommendation to the City Council according to the applicable criteria specified above.
